This park is more for those with mud in their veins. There are some fun caves to go exploring, great camping facilities, a cool pool with a sweet rope swing, and an on facility diner. There are some more advanced trails but they require you to have roll cage/bars to get on them. I did have some fun in the mud and got to do a good shake down run on the truck though so overall we had a really good time. The main trail (marked by green) is a dirt road that varies from 3 car widths to single and it loops around the entire facility. All of the trails are marked and correspond with the provided map but it can still be a bit confusing at times. We got lost once or twice and just had to keep driving until we found a bigger landmark. The yellow trails are the Mild terrain and some of them are only wide enough for ATVs which is only mildly annoying that it doesn't differentiate on the map. On the yellow trails you will find a bunch of mud holes and the occasional one will drop off a foot or two without warning which makes for some good entertainment. A large change of pace from the rocks of Utah that i'm used to =).
